@More_Badass seems like you are one of our biggest fans hahaha and also you're very "tuned" with some of our ideas too ;D

Actually we were thinking about a Splinter Cell / MGS4 / Team fortress (weird fusion of things btw) like multiplayer consisting in a fight between plants and spec-ops, with every member of each team having exclusive abilities.

Other mode could consist in a "find and capture the plant" with 3 / 4 security comrades searching for the alien and other player sneaking trough different scenarios, all of them against the clock.
I think this last idea implemented in the Wii U with the plant-player seeing the position of the rest of friends on the gamepad could be awesome.

"Meanwhile at the Bioarma area, a group of engineers have developed a new armor, the Drifter, connected to a high tech helmet that expands the reflects and abilities of the user within an exoskeleton. But during the tests with humans something went wrong, and the armor gets damaged by an overload of hyper light energy flux. Now the Drifter is out of control and hunting every live being on it's path"

Yes, it's for real! This is the way you will find "The Drifter", a new easter egg boss in Paradise Lost. We teamed-up with Heart Machine, developer of Hyper Light Drifter, working together to include cameos in both games.
